National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ST) The National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ST) is a U.S. federal agency that develops and promotes measurement standards, including those for cybersecurity. NIST's Cybersecurity Framework (CSF) is widely adopted across industries to manage and mitigate cybersecurity risks. The framework provides a structured approach to identifying, assessing, and managing cybersecurity risks, making it a critical tool for organizations seeking to enhance their cybersecurity posture. This guide provides valuable tips to help you master these skills. Critical Thinking Analyze Syllogisms 1. Understand the Structure: A syllogism consists of two premises and a conclusion. Identify the major premise, minor premise, and conclusion. 2. Check Validity: Ensure the conclusion logically follows from the premises. A syllogism is valid if the conclusion must be true when the premises are true. 3. Identify Terms: Clearly identify the subject, predicate, and middle term. Ensure the middle term is distributed at least once on the premises. 4. Avoid Ambiguities: Watch for ambiguous terms and ensure each term is used consistently. Make Inferences 1. The Kenyan Finance Bill 2024 has been amended to better reflect public input and concerns. Here's a simple breakdown of what these changes mean for everyday Kenyans: Major Tax Adjustments 1. No VAT on Essential Goods The 16% Value Added Tax (VAT) on bread, sugar transportation, financial services, and foreign exchange transactions has been removed. This means these items and services will not become more expensive. 2. Motor Vehicle Tax The proposed 2.5% tax on motor vehicles has been scrapped. This will help keep car prices from rising too much. 3. No Extra Charges on Mobile Money Transfers There will be no increase in fees for transferring money via mobile services like M-Pesa. This is good news for everyone who uses mobile money for daily transactions. Support for Local Businesses and Farmers 4. 💭Introduction - A call for thought; The Kenyan Finance Bill 2024 has been introduced to overhaul the country’s tax system to enhance revenue collection and improve compliance. However, the proposed changes have sparked widespread concern due to their potential negative impacts on the economy, businesses, investors, and citizens. This article provides a detailed overview of the bill's key provisions, examines the potential adverse effects, and presents a critical analysis of its broader implications. Key Provisions of the Finance Bill 2024 Motor Vehicle Tax The bill proposes a new motor vehicle tax of 2.5% on the value of vehicles, payable when acquiring insurance coverage. The tax ranges from a minimum of KSh 5,000 to a maximum of KSh 100,000 depending on the vehicle's value.
